Thursday, January 22, 2026

Search results for keyword: Science found in 1513 News.

Science and technology
  • by david hall
Vaccine researchers are preparing for Disease X

They hope to be able to create new vaccines in just four months

Science and technology
  • by david hall
Science and technology
  • by david hall
Adding new DNA letters make novel proteins possible

One such, a cancer drug, is now in development

Science and technology
  • by david hall